Yes, Project Linus quilts can be made from panels. I make about 50 to 100 Project Linus quilts each year for donation, and the "SusyBee" panels are my favorite to use but I also piece quilts....many of them have been posted to this board. Thank you for making a quilt for Project Linus.

I enjoy sewing for PL because of the fact that most anything is acceptable. My chapter gives to preemies thru 18[yr. olds so any size, any color, etc. works for someone. I was told that hospitalized children often prefer a smaller quilt since they use it on the bed over hospital bedding. I like to think that colorful quilts brighten up someone's day--and even the day of hospital staff.
